Re: underscore pattern in a query doens't work
От | Tom Lane |
---|---|
Тема | Re: underscore pattern in a query doens't work |
Дата | |
Msg-id | 26099.1347545981@sss.pgh.pa.us обсуждение исходный текст |
Ответ на | underscore pattern in a query doens't work ("Sergio Calero." <angusyoung4@yahoo.es>) |
Ответы |
Re: underscore pattern in a query doens't work
|
Список | pgsql-sql |
"Sergio Calero." <angusyoung4@yahoo.es> writes: > I'd like to execute a query using the underscore as a pattern. > select id,etiqueta from limites_municipales where etiqueta like 'Garaf_a'; > [ but this fails to match 'Garaf�a' ] I suspect what you have here is an encoding problem. That is, probably the "�" is represented as a multi-byte character (most likely UTF8) but the server thinks it's working with a single-byte encoding so that any one character should be only one byte. You didn't say what your encoding setup is, so it's hard to do more than speculate. > PostgreSQL 8.4.1 on x86_64-unknown-linux-gnu, compiled by GCC gcc (GCC) 3.4.6 20060404 (Red Hat 3.4.6-10), 64-bit You do realize this is about 3 years out of date? The 8.4 series is up to release 8.4.13, and a lot of those updates contained fixes for serious bugs. regards, tom lane
В списке pgsql-sql по дате отправления: